About the Author

Bob Belton

Lover of Virginia History. Family Historian. Aspiring Novelist.

Born into the deep-rooted traditions of Virginia, the author is a fifth-generation native of Richmond whose lifelong fascination with history began along the hallowed streets, battlefields and rivers of Virginia. Raised in a family where stories were passed down as treasured heirlooms, he developed an early appreciation for the people, legends, triumphs, and tragedies that shaped both his family and his beloved state. Proud of his Irish heritage and deeply connected to Virginia's historic identity. Like many Virginians, he came to see history not as distant events in dusty books, but as something living — whispered through old family photographs, and carried in the memories of generations. Educated at Benedictine Prep, Belmont Abbey College and Virginia Commonwealth University, he combined academic study with a storyteller's imagination and an historian's heart. This book is not a conventional history. Instead, it is an amalgam of family lore, historical reality, and creative fiction. Within its pages, readers will encounter characters inspired by the author's own ancestors alongside real historical figures and fictional personalities shaped by the spirit of actual little known historical events. The result is a richly layered narrative that blurs the line between memory and myth, history and imagination. For the author, history is not merely something to remember. It is part of who we really are.
